The Infinite Happiness
An immersion into the architectural experiment “8 House,” the iconic building by BIG – Bjarke Ingels Group on the outskirts of Copenhagen, conceived as a “vertical village” where hundreds of residents coexist in a model of modern community. For one month, Ila Bêka and Louise Lemoine live and film from within this architectural utopia, capturing moments of everyday life, intimacy, and togetherness. With sensitivity and humor, the film explores how far architecture can go in creating community and a shared happiness.
